Immunodeficiency 12 (ID12) Overview
Immunodeficiency 12, also known as Common Variable Immunodeficiency-12 with Autoimmunity (CVID12), is a rare genetic primary immunodeficiency disorder. It is characterized by recurrent infections and associated with hypogammaglobulinemia, which is a condition where the body produces low levels of antibodies.
Key Features:
- Recurrent Infections: People with ID12 are highly susceptible to infections from foreign invaders such as bacteria, viruses, or other pathogens.
- Hypogammaglobulinemia: The body's ability to produce antibodies is impaired, making it difficult to fight off infections.
- Autoimmune Features: About half of patients develop autoimmune features, including cytopenia (low blood cell counts), generalized inflammation, and other symptoms.

Common Signs and Symptoms of Immunodeficiency
Immunodeficiency disorders can manifest in various ways, and it's essential to be aware of the common signs and symptoms. According to medical experts [8], some of the typical indicators include:
- Frequent Infections: People with immunodeficiency may experience repeated infections, such as ear infections, sinus infections, pneumonia, bronchitis, meningitis, or skin infections.
- Chronic Diarrhea: Immunodeficiency can lead to chronic diarrhea, which can be a persistent and uncomfortable symptom [12].
- Fatigue: Feeling extremely tired, like when you have the flu, could indicate an issue with your body's defenses [11].
- Swollen Spleen, Liver, or Lymph Nodes: Inflammation of these organs can be a sign of immunodeficiency [7].
If you experience two or more of these signs, it is recommended to consult a doctor about the possibility of primary immunodeficiency.

Diagnostic Tests for Immunodeficiency
Immunodeficiency disorders can be diagnosed through various laboratory tests and examinations. Here are some of the common diagnostic tests used to identify these conditions:
- Blood tests: Blood tests can determine if you have typical levels of infection-fighting proteins (immunoglobulins) in your blood [1]. These tests can also measure different parts of the immune system, which is important for diagnosing primary immunodeficiency (PI) [2].
- Complete blood count (CBC): A CBC with manual differential can help identify abnormalities in the immune system [3].
- Quantitative immunoglobulin measurements: This test measures the levels of specific antibodies in the blood, which can indicate a serious health problem if abnormal [10].
- Complement levels in the blood: Testing complement levels in the blood can help diagnose immunodeficiency disorders [4].
- Genetic tests: Genetic tests can identify mutations on genes that may be causing the immunodeficiency disorder. There are three types of genetic testing used to diagnose PI: panel testing, whole exome sequencing (WES), and whole genome sequencing (WGS) [9].

Treatment of Immunodeficiency Disorders
According to search result [12], treatment of immunodeficiency disorders usually involves preventing infections, treating infections when they occur, and replacing parts of the immune system.
- Preventing Infections: This can be achieved through good hygiene practices, avoiding close contact with people who are sick, and getting vaccinated against certain diseases.
- Treating Infections: When an infection does occur, it is essential to seek medical attention promptly. Antibiotics, antiviral medications, or other treatments may be prescribed depending on the type of infection.
- Replacing Parts of the Immune System: For individuals with severe immunodeficiency disorders, treatment may involve replacing parts of the immune system, such as through immunoglobulin therapy (see below).
Immunoglobulin Therapy
Search result [14] mentions that immunoglobulin therapy is used to treat immune deficiencies and various autoimmune conditions. This type of treatment involves administering antibodies to help boost the immune system.
- How it Works: Immunoglobulin therapy works by providing the body with a supply of antibodies, which can help fight off infections.
- Uses: This treatment is often used for individuals with primary immunodeficiency disorders, such as those with antibody deficiencies.

Differential Diagnosis of Immunodeficiency
Immunodeficiency disorders can be challenging to diagnose, as they often present with non-specific symptoms that can mimic other conditions. A differential diagnosis is a process of ruling out other possible causes of the symptoms and identifying the underlying condition.
In the context of immunodeficiency, differential diagnoses may include:
- Monoclonal gammopathy: This is a condition characterized by the presence of abnormal proteins in the blood, which can be ruled out through monoclonal protein level tests [12].
- Hereditary hemochromatosis: This is a genetic disorder that affects iron metabolism and can lead to excessive iron accumulation in the body. Ferritin levels can help rule out this condition [12].
Other differential diagnoses for immunodeficiency may include:
- Autoimmune disorders: These are conditions where the immune system attacks healthy tissues, such as rheumatoid arthritis or lupus.
- Infections: Bacterial, viral, fungal, and protozoal infections can all be considered in the differential diagnosis of immunodeficiency.
It's essential to consider a wide range of possibilities when diagnosing immunodeficiency disorders. A comprehensive evaluation, including laboratory tests and clinical assessments, is necessary to determine the underlying cause of the symptoms [1-15].
